** The Dodge repair market serving Graysville, GA, is characterized by a small number of highly specialized, high-quality independent shops that have emerged to fill a niche largely unmet by the local dealership network. Due to Graysville's rural nature, residents are accustomed to traveling a short distance (10-20 minutes) to Ringgold or Fort Oglethorpe for specialized automotive services. The competition among these top-tier specialists is strong, which drives a high standard of quality and technical knowledge. These shops compete directly with dealerships in Chattanooga by offering more personalized service, deeper expertise in performance modifications, and often more competitive labor rates. **Typical Pricing:** For specialized HEMI and SRT services, pricing is premium but generally 15-30% lower than the nearby metropolitan dealerships. A typical Hellcat supercharger service can range from $800-$1,200, while a full HEMI engine rebuild for a 5.7L or 6.4L can range from $7,000 to $12,000+, depending on the extent of the work and performance upgrades. Basic diagnostics typically start at $150-$200. The market supports this pricing due to the high level of expertise required and the value of the vehicles being serviced.

What are the most common Dodge repair issues you see in Graysville, and are any related to our local climate or roads?

For trucks like the Ram 1500, we frequently address suspension and steering component wear due to our rural Graysville roads and occasional rough terrain. For Dodge Chargers and Challengers, cooling system issues are common, exacerbated by Georgia's summer heat. Regular inspections of these systems are key for local drivers.

How can I find a reputable, specialized Dodge repair shop in the Graysville area?

Look for shops that are Mopar® certified or have technicians with specific Dodge/Chrysler training, which indicates specialized knowledge. Check reviews from local customers in Graysville and nearby Ringgold for consistent positive feedback on Dodge repairs, and ask if they use OEM or high-quality aftermarket parts.

When should I seek immediate repair service for my Dodge in Graysville versus scheduling a routine check-up?

Seek immediate service for warning lights like the red temperature gauge (overheating) or check engine light with noticeable performance loss, especially before tackling hilly North Georgia roads. Schedule routine check-ups for maintenance reminders, minor vibrations, or before long trips on I-75 to ensure reliability.

What is a general price range for common Dodge repairs at Graysville shops, like brake service or a cooling system repair?

Pricing varies by model, but for a Dodge Ram or Durango, a standard brake pad and rotor replacement typically ranges from $350-$600 per axle locally. Cooling system repairs, such as radiator or thermostat replacement, often fall between $400-$800, depending on parts and labor rates at the specific Graysville shop.

Are there any local Graysville considerations for Dodge diesel truck owners regarding maintenance or repairs?

Yes, ensure your chosen shop has experience with the Cummins diesel engine, specifically for models like the Ram 2500/3500. Given our region's humidity, monitoring for fuel algae (diesel bug) in your tank is important, and using a reputable local fuel station is advised for fuel quality.
